Apeles is the name of the solo project of the Brazilian composer, musician, and singer Eduardo Praça. With nearly two decades of experience and guitar strings broken along the way, Eduardo carries with him a unique artistic journey marked by constant lyrical and sonic experimentation. From the young rocker who wielded the guitars of the iconic band Ludovic, he later revealed himself as a composer and vocalist in the duo Quarto Negro. From 2017 onwards, Eduardo began concentrating his creative process on developing Apeles. In his new solo project, set to debut in early 2024, he explores sounds like exquisite-pop, shoegaze, and disco music, featuring guest musicians from around the world, such as the British rapper Awate and the Italian Colombre. These diverse influences make Apeles a catalyst for different musical and poetic elements. It's a poetic project produced in collaboration with musician Thiago Klein, his former partner from the band Quarto Negro, and under the musical direction of Helio Flanders. In his discography, you can find two albums - Rio do Tempo (2017) and Crux (2019) - along with a series of cinematic music videos, another great passion. With an artistic journey forged by extreme curiosity and extensive research, this kind of experimentation is nothing unusual when you listen to Apeles.
